Pike is looking good......I look forward to seeing more pics as your work progresses. :trsuit: Length seems okay, as best I can tell. My pike is 53.5 inches long from base to tip. And you appear to be holding your pike correctly.....with your hand clasped around the handle and finger extended towards the trigger and base. When you hold it correctly like this, it shaves a few inches off the height. You'll notice most people's first instinct is to cup their hand underneath the base...which raises the pike even higher up, creating a false sense of it being "too tall".
